Considering the different pinctrl configurations for the same client device usually share the same pinmux and only pinconf varies. It may worth introducing another level phandle reference. Something like the following:I don't think there's a need for another level of indirection. The 1:n model I was talking about already handles this, I believe. See below.quoted
pinmux_sdhci: pinmux-sdhci { mux = <&tegra_pmx TEGRA_PMX_PG_DTA TEGRA_PMX_MUX_1> <&tegra_pmx TEGRA_PMX_PG_DTD TEGRA_PMX_MUX_1>; }; pinconf_sdhci_active: pinconf-sdhci-active { config = <&tegra_pmx TEGRA_PMX_PG_DTA TEGRA_PMX_CONF_DRIVE_STRENGTH 5> <&tegra_pmx TEGRA_PMX_PG_DTD TEGRA_PMX_CONF_DRIVE_STRENGTH 5> <&tegra_pmx TEGRA_PMX_PG_DTA TEGRA_PMX_CONF_SLEW_RATE 4> <&tegra_pmx TEGRA_PMX_PG_DTD TEGRA_PMX_CONF_SLEW_RATE 8>; }; pinconf_sdhci_suspend: pinconf-sdhci-suspend { config = <&tegra_pmx TEGRA_PMX_PG_DTA TEGRA_PMX_CONF_TRISTATE 1> <&tegra_pmx TEGRA_PMX_PG_DTD TEGRA_PMX_CONF_TRISTATE 1> <&tegra_pmx TEGRA_PMX_PG_DTA TEGRA_PMX_CONF_DRIVE_STRENGTH 5> <&tegra_pmx TEGRA_PMX_PG_DTD TEGRA_PMX_CONF_DRIVE_STRENGTH 5> <&tegra_pmx TEGRA_PMX_PG_DTA TEGRA_PMX_CONF_SLEW_RATE 4> <&tegra_pmx TEGRA_PMX_PG_DTD TEGRA_PMX_CONF_SLEW_RATE 8>; };Those 3 nodes make sense to me.quoted
pinctrl_sdhci_active: pinctrl-sdhci-active { pinmux = <&pinmux_sdhci>; pinconf = <&pinconf_sdhci_active>; }; pinctrl_sdhci_suspend: pinctrl-sdhci-suspend { pinmux = <&pinmux_sdhci>; pinconf = <&pinconf_sdhci_suspend>; };I think we can avoid those 2 nodes.quoted
sdhci at c8000200 { ... pinctrl = <&pinctrl_sdhci_active> <&pinctrl_sdhci_suspend>; pinctrl-names = "active", "suspend"; };And rewrite that node as: sdhci at c8000200 { ... pinctrl = <&pinmux_sdhci> <&pinconf_sdhci_active> <&pinmux_sdhci> <&pinconf_sdhci_suspend>; pinctrl-names = "active", "active", "suspend", "suspend"; }; The only slight disadvantage here is that the person constructing the pinctrl/pinctrl-names properties needs to know to explicitly list both the separate mux/config phandles for each value in pinctrl-names. Still, this seems a reasonable compromise; the user is still picking from a bunch of pre- defined/canned nodes, they simply need to list 2 (or n in general) of them for each state.quoted
This will be pretty useful for imx6 usdhc case, which will have 3 pinctrl configuration for each usdhc device (imx6 has 4 usdhc devices), pinctrl-50mhz, pinctrl-100mhz and pinctrl-200mhz. All these 3 states have the exactly same pinmux settings, and only varies on pinconf.Yes, I definitely agree there's a need for this. As an aside, I wonder if the following would be any better: sdhci at c8000200 { ... pinctrl = <&pinmux_sdhci> <&pinconf_sdhci_active> <&pinmux_sdhci> <&pinconf_sdhci_suspend>; /* Number of entries in pinctrl for each in pinctrl-names */ pinctrl-entries = <2 2>; pinctrl-names = "active", "suspend"; }; That seems more complex though.
